Please put up stop signs at each entrance to Kepler Loop on Brisbon rd. A fourway stop would be good at the Cantler, Brisbon and Kepler Loop area. This row of town houses on Kepler Loop is part of Creekside and the residents need to cross a busy street to get to their community. A little boy was killed here crossing the road. Pedestrian crosswalks and speedbumps along the road with additional lighting would be beneficial. Many people speed down this road and we have both children and adults who walk on Brisbon. With the amount of cars that come down this road with the Sterling Apartments, Creekside and other houses, it would need to be addressed as quickly as possible. People use this road as it is another way to connect Ford and Harris Trail. They do not go the speed limit of 35 but way over that on multiple occasions.

City and County representatives met to discuss the proper next steps after receiving the incident report from Georgia State Patrol and its review by Richmond Hill Police Department.
It was agreed upon that the City and County should engage a professional traffic and pedestrian safety consultant to perform a study in the area in order to determine the best solution. We have engaged with a very qualified consultant in Kimley-Horn. Their team includes four professional traffic operations engineers and two certified Road Safety Professionals, which is a certification achieved through a high level of practice and knowledge in the road safety profession.
Kimley-Horn proposes we complete a Road Safety Audit (RSA) for Brisbon Road. The RSA is a safety performance examination of an existing roadway corridor by an independent multi-disciplinary audit team; and is widely viewed as a proactive, innovative approach to improving safety and have been implemented nationwide for this purpose. Based on their extensive experience, Kimley-Horn believes an RSA would best serve the City and County and would achieve these primary objectives:
• Quickly implement effective safety countermeasures along Brisbon Road
• Adequately plan for future needs along the Brisbon Road corridor and surrounding area
• Identify potential, similar areas of concern within Richmond Hill
All of the suggested solutions and feedback provided to the City via email, SeeClickFix, etc. will continue to be relayed to the consultant for review and consideration as part of the RSA. The City anticipates receiving the final RSA within a few months. We will keep you updated as this process continues.
